Transaction 75b71849c82a58f1dede351c0adeb5bbfc170aa07bf4887a328e491c213591c9
1 Input
1 Output
-
75b71849c82a58f1dede351c0adeb5bbfc170aa07bf4887a328e491c213591c9:0
- value
- 173233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d5705b490e53808b97db5c941a81a4fcd015f38 OP_EQUAL
- address
- 37HMPfE4zbwRssSrD97VwjsWRBoZduY4kF